【第六屆中國智慧城市博覽會】【The 6th China Smart City Expo Report】

由國家發展和改革委員會(發改委) 指導,中國城市和小城鎮改革發展中心及智慧城市發展聯盟舉辦的 「中國智慧城市博覽會」(智博會) 2020年12月3至5日 在北京展覽館舉行。香港智慧城市聯盟(SCC) 在會上設置「香港智慧城市展館」,向內地官員及企業,展示26家香港公司的物聯網、金融科技、信息安全企業。
 
「香港智慧城市展館」獲香港特別行政區政府工業貿易署「工商機構支援基金」撥款資助。香港數碼港、香港資訊科技聯會、香港軟件行業協會為合作單位。
 
中國智慧城市博覽會(簡稱「智博會」) 是智慧城市國內外交流合作的重要平台。 本屆展會共有200 家參展商,鑑於疫情尚未消退,為嚴格落實國家和北京市關於疫情防控要求,人流控制,入場人次為每日不超過5,000人。
 
香港智慧城市聯盟會長楊文銳透過「香港智慧城市展館」現場的大屏幕,向進場的領導、企業和參觀人士介紹香港智慧城市的概況。他特別提到網絡保安、金融科技、即將推出的數碼個人身份,及空間數據平台等的未來發展。楊文銳表示,希望可以將香港及國際良好的科技及標準帶到內地,同樣地也希望向內地的高新科技學習;他相信香港和內地在未來日子會有更多緊密合作。
 
當前中國有超過500個城市正在推動智慧城市建設。通過融合發展5G、人工智能、大數據、雲計算、物聯網、BIM等新興技術產業和應用模式,智慧城市將為城市帶來治理能力和治理體系的現代化升級。
 
根據我們的問卷調查,各位參展商對於香港智慧城市展館的安排非常滿意,因為可乘此次機會和業界交流意見和將來發展機會。所有參加香港館的受訪參展商認為是次參展對公司有幫助,主要原因包括藉此了解內地情況、建立生意網絡夥伴及開拓內地市場。而共有96%參展商都認為會再次參與這類展覽會。
 
SCC set up a Smart City Pavilion at the “Hong Kong Smart City Pavilion” in China Smart City International Expo held at the Beijing Exhibition Hall on 3-5 December 2020 to promote Hong Kong smart city services to mainland users and officials.
 
Organised by China Centre for Urban Development (CCUD) and Smart City Development Alliance (SCDA), the China Smart City Expo is a leading event of its kind in China.  At the HK Smart City Pavilion, the products or services of 26 Hong Kong companies in IoT, FinTech and Information Security sectors were presented to mainland users.  The pavilion was sponsored by the Trade and Industrial Organisation Support Fund from the Trade and Industry Department of HKSAR Government, with Cyberport, Hong Kong Software Industry Association, and Hong Kong Information Technology Joint Council as Collaborating Organizations.
 
Publicity efforts included event website, press releases and advertisements targeted at mainland media, event booklets and TV wall introducing the performance of the Hong Kong ICT sectors.
 
The 2020 Expo attracted 200 exhibitors and 5,000 visitors daily, the drop in visitor number was due to the limitation of number of visitors in response to the anti-pandemic measures.   According to the questionnaire of HK Pavilion, all the exhibitors mentioned that the participation helped them to understand the situation and demand of mainland market and 96% of the exhibitors would like to join again if there is opportunity in future.
